Description
Business Details
This highly regarded and long-standing business has been successfully run by the current owners since 1982, having been bought from the founding owners who established in 1939. The business shows extremely consistent accounts and an extremely healthy profit margin. There is no advertising outlay due to the high level of loyal and regular customers derived from the local residents and businesses, as well as the high volume of footfall and passing traffic due to the close proximity to popular tourist attractions, regular markets and high street shopping.
Due to the confidentiality of the sale and before any further information is provided, a non-disclosure agreement would need to be signed.
The Building
The freehold building consists of the shop premises which is over two floors and includes the main retail area, back preparation area and a basement level with toilets. In addition there are three studio flats above the shop, with independent access. All are currently tenanted.

Location
Busy prime trading location within historic central Hexham, Northumberland. Overlooking the 'Shambles', Hexham Abbey and Old Gaol it enjoys excellent footfall from both locals and tourists. Regular market and event days also ensure this is regularly busy with pedestrian traffic
Stock & Equipment
Approximately 2000 worth of food stock. The range of equipment includes a 3-pan Preston & Thomas fryer, Large peeler, Chipper, Cooler, Filter machine, Dishwasher, Hob, Hot water dispenser, Fridge freezer, Two Freezers, Counter & Till, Service lift and Emergency fire shutter.
